DONLEY SEALS HIS CITY LOAN SWITCH
The Sentinel
|August 07, 2025
Spurs midfielder completes move to the bet365 Stadium ahead of opening Championship clash
JAMIE Donley took advice from fellow Spurs loanee Ashley Phillips before opting to join Stoke City.
Stoke City yesterday announced his arrival for their 2025/26 Championship campaign, and the 20-year-old Northern Ireland international explained what prompted him to head to the bet365 Stadium amid interest from rival clubs.
He said: "I had a few teams after me, but I decided on Stoke when the gaffer [Mark Robins] called while I was away on tour with Spurs.
"The way he wants to play, both in terms of attacking and defending, definitely suits me.
"I had a chat with Ash [Phillips] too and he said it's a great club, with good people in the building, and he can definitely see me contributing to the team in a positive way."
